Indima yeeTransformer Cores kwiinkqubo zoMbane

Ii-transformer cores zinoxanduva lokudlulisa amandla ombane ukusuka kwi-primary winding ukuya kwi-secondary winding ngokungenisa i-electromagnetic. Ngaphandle kwe-core, ukudluliselwa kwamandla bekungayi kuba luncedo, kwaye kuya kwenzeka ilahleko ezinkulu zamandla. I-core isebenza njengendlela ye-magnetic, ivumela i-magnetic field eveliswa yi-primary winding ukuba ibangele i-voltage kwi-secondary winding. Izinto ze-core kufuneka zibe neempawu ezithile ukuqinisekisa ukusebenza kakuhle kunye nokusebenza kakuhle.

Ukulahleka Okungundoqo

Ukulahleka kwe-core, okwaziwa ngokuba kukulahleka kwesinyithi, kubhekisa ekuchithekeni kwamandla okwenzeka kwi-core ngenxa ye-hysteresis kunye ne-eddy currents. Ukulahleka kwe-hysteresis kubangelwa ngamandla afunekayo ukuze kutsalwe kwaye kususwe imagnethi yezinto eziphambili, ngelixa ukulahleka kwe-eddy current kuvela kwi-circulating currents ngaphakathi kwi-core. Ukunciphisa ukulahleka kwe-core kubalulekile ukuphucula ukusebenza kakuhle kwe-transformer. Izinto ezahlukeneyo eziphambili zibonisa amanqanaba ahlukeneyo okulahleka kwe-core, nto leyo eyenza kube yimfuneko ukukhetha ngononophelo izinto ngokusekelwe kwiimfuno zesicelo.

Uxinano lweMagnetic Flux

Uxinano lwe-magnetic flux luyinto ebalulekileyo kuyilo lwe-transformer core. Lumisela ubungakanani bamandla e-magnetizing afunekayo ukufikelela kwinqanaba elithile le-magnetism. Izixhobo ze-core zinemida eyahlukeneyo ye-magnetic saturation, enokuchaphazela ukusebenza kwe-transformer iyonke. Ukusebenzisa i-core kwindawo yayo yokugcwala okanye kufutshane nayo kunokukhokelela ekulahlekelweni okwandisiweyo kunye nokuncipha kokusebenza kakuhle. Iinjineli kufuneka ziqwalasele ngononophelo iimfuno ze-magnetic flux density ukuqinisekisa ukusebenza kwe-core efanelekileyo.

Impembelelo yoMgangatho waMandla ekusebenzeni kweZixhobo zoGuquguquko
Umgangatho wamandla (PQ) yinto ebalulekileyo emisela ukusebenza, ukusebenza kakuhle, kunye nobude bexesha lezixhobo zombane. Ngokwenyani, i-PQ ibhekisa kwinqanaba lokuphambuka kwamandla ombane kwi-sinusoidal waveform yayo efanelekileyo ngokwe-frequency, i-voltage, kunye ne-current. Umgangatho wamandla aphezulu uthetha ukuba amandla ombane anikezelweyo ahambelana ngokugqibeleleyo ne-sine wave efanelekileyo, nto leyo ekhokelela ekusebenzeni kakuhle kwezixhobo zombane.


Kwimeko yokusebenza kwezixhobo ze-transformer, i-PQ idlala indima ebalulekileyo. Ii-transformer, njengezinto ezibalulekileyo kwiinkqubo zamandla, zifuna amandla asemgangathweni ophezulu ukuze zisebenze ngokufanelekileyo nangokukhuselekileyo. Ukusebenza kwezixhobo ze-transformer kuhambelana ngqo nomgangatho wamandla eziwafumanayo. I-PQ elungileyo iqinisekisa ukuba ii-transformer zisebenza ngamandla azo aphezulu ngelixa zinciphisa ukulahleka kwamandla kwaye zandisa ubomi bazo benkonzo.


Kwelinye icala, i-PQ embi inokukhokelela kwimiba emininzi efana nokushisa kakhulu, ukusetyenziswa kwamandla okwandisiweyo, ixesha eliphantsi lokusebenza kwezixhobo, kwanokusilela okukhulu. Ke ngoko, ukuqonda nokugcina i-PQ ephezulu kubalulekile ekuphuculeni ukusebenza kwezixhobo ze-transformer nokuqinisekisa ukuthembeka kweenkqubo zamandla.
